Review Summary:

Rotorua Top 10 Holiday Park offers a solid experience for travelers looking for comfortable accommodation amidst vibrant geothermal activity. Reviews on platforms like TripAdvisor and Google reflect a generally positive sentiment, highlighting the park's clean facilities and welcoming atmosphere. Guests appreciate the range of accommodation options, from camping sites to cabins, making it suitable for families and solo travelers alike. Many note the park's proximity to local attractions, such as the famous geysers and hot springs. However, some customers mentioned that the noise from nearby roads could be disruptive at times. Overall, Rotorua Top 10 provides a convenient base for exploring the area, with friendly staff and essential amenities that meet expectations.

Review Summary:

Tasman Holiday Parks - Miranda offers a pleasant experience for travelers seeking a serene getaway. According to reviews on platforms like TripAdvisor and Google Reviews, guests often appreciate the well-maintained facilities and the peaceful surroundings. Many highlight the spacious and clean cabins, along with the friendly staff who go the extra mile to ensure a comfortable stay.The park's hot pools receive mixed feedback; some visitors love the relaxation they provide, while others wish for better maintenance. Families particularly enjoy the playground and the close proximity to local attractions. Overall, Miranda is seen as a solid choice for those looking to unwind, although a few improvements could enhance the experience further.

Review Summary:

Hihi Beach Holiday Camp offers a relaxed, family-friendly atmosphere with a few standout features. Customers on sites like Tripadvisor and Google Reviews have noted the camp's proximity to the beach, making it ideal for swimming and kayaking. The facilities are generally well-maintained, although some guests have mentioned that the kitchens could use a bit more attention.Many appreciate the spacious camping sites and the helpfulness of the staff. Some reviews highlight the communal areas, describing them as a great place to meet fellow travelers. In contrast, a few guests pointed out occasional noise from neighboring sites. Overall, Hihi Beach Holiday Camp is a solid choice for those looking to enjoy a laid-back holiday by the sea.

Review Summary:

Tokerau Beach Motor Camp is a tranquil getaway that appeals to families and travelers seeking a relaxed atmosphere. According to reviews on platforms like Google and Tripadvisor, many guests appreciate the camp's proximity to the stunning Tokerau Beach, making it perfect for water activities and relaxing walks. Facilities are generally well-maintained, and visitors highlight the clean bathrooms and friendly staff. Some reviews note that while the camp can get busy during peak season, the overall environment remains peaceful. A few guests mention that the cabins could use some updates, but they find the experience enjoyable and the views worth it.Overall, Tokerau Beach Motor Camp offers solid value for those looking to unwind in a picturesque setting without the frills.
